Take a stand against the horror of rubbish presents – do your festive shopping with Oxfam Unwrapped.

It's a simple idea: rather than the usual xmas tat, buy someone a gift related to Oxfam's work and make a real difference to the world. This year there's even more to choose from, including fertiliser (the gift of dung), condoms to fight HIV and AIDS, and even a toilet. Go on, give a loo to the world.
